MLS: Chivas USA 3, Toronto 1

TORONTO (UPI) -- Ante Razov had a goal and two assists Saturday to lead Chivas USA to 3-1 Major League Soccer win over Toronto FC.

Toronto scored first when Tyler Rosenlund picked up a feed from Rohan Ricketts and put the ball into an empty net in the 30th minute. Daniel Paladini scored the equalizer just before halftime, and Jonathan Bornstein scored what turned out to be the decisive goal in the 58th minute.

Razov capped the scoring in stoppage time.

The victory lifted Chivas USA (7-9-6) into a tie with the idle Colorado Rapids for third place in the Western Conference, with 27 points apiece.

Toronto FC (7-10-5 ), with 26 points, is tied for last in the East with Kansas City.
